Gate Valve for On-Off Applications

Gate valves are ideal for isolation rather than flow regulation. Gate valves perform well in high-pressure environments. Their robust construction supports demanding operating conditions.

Butterfly Valve for Compact and Efficient Control

A butterfly valve uses a rotating disc to regulate fluid flow efficiently. These valves are widely used in water treatment, HVAC, and industrial systems. They are ideal for systems requiring frequent operation.

Ductile Iron Pipe Fitting for Infrastructure Projects

Ductile iron pipe fittings are known for their strength and flexibility. Their durability ensures long service life with minimal maintenance. They adapt to ground movement without failure.

Ductile Iron Pipe for Water and Sewage Applications

These pipes perform well under varying pressure conditions. Ductile iron pipe offers excellent resistance to corrosion and mechanical stress. Protective linings and coatings further enhance durability.
